The Breakdown - Just a Bad Day for the Bills?
Could it simply have been an emotional letdown from defeating Kansas City last week or something more? This remains the question for the Bills to address
The Buffalo squad had won seven in a consecutive games against Miami but were second best from the start as the Dolphins ran out 30-13 winners in an eye-opening outcome - and performance
MVP quarterback Josh Allen only got the team's opening first down in the third quarter and initial scoring in the final quarter - admittedly Miami had ten days to prepare but it was still a massive egg laid by one of the NFL's top offences
Tua Tagovailoa passed for two touchdowns but rusher Achane was the devastating difference, with 225 combined yards and two touchdowns
Containing the league's best rushing attack was crucial too, with James Cook and teammates recording just eighty-six yards, their fewest of the year and slightly more than half their 161.5-yard average
Additionally there were the three crucial turnovers, and the pair from Allen specifically. An pass caught by defense in the end zone resulting in a nine-minute drive produced nothing, and his fourth-quarter fumble that Miami turned into seven points just later
It was typical 'previous Bills teams' as they hurt themselves in the foot, getting into a deficit on defense and Josh Allen attempting to overcompensate to rescue his squad from the situation - rather than the calm, disciplined, balanced Buffalo team we've seen this season
The Dolphins have demonstrated a varied performances this season so the jury's out on whether this is the beginning of something, but for the Bills they'll require an instant response in a difficult matchup against Tampa Bay next week as the New England are quietly moving into a comfortable advantage at the top of the American Football Conference East
Spotlight - New England See Path to Surprise Top Seed
Regarding the New England, they're one of three different eight and two teams in the league, all AFC sides, but are they the top team?
You can find flaws in New England, the Broncos and the Colts actually for feasting on the weaker opponents, with only five of their combined twenty-four victories coming against teams with a positive record - and one of those was the Colts beating the Broncos
The Broncos defeated the champion Eagles in Philly and are masters of the fourth-quarter while Indy can ride Jonathan Taylor, but the Patriots including Sunday's win in Tampa to their primtime success in Orchard Park seems like a statement
Their two defeats occurred in new head coach Vrabel's initial three games, with seven consecutive victories, similar to Denver, since then - but taking down Baker Mayfield after the Buccaneers had a bye to get ready was huge
Drake Maye's MVP claims won't go away, and he certainly earns point for courage after absorbing some hard tackles in Tampa Bay but persevering to guide his side to victory
The defensive unit is reliable and first-year running back Henderson burst onto the scene on Sunday with 147 yards and two exhilerating touchdowns of 55 and 69 yards - establishing himself as just the fifth different runner to break 22 miles per hour this year on his initial touchdown
Although you can debate who 'the top team' is technically, the Patriots should be favourites to end with the best record due to their schedule - which includes just one game against a successful opponent, although a significant contest against the Bills
Traveling to the Ravens is also tough, but Denver have it even tougher in the AFC West division with the Kansas City to face two times, the Los Angeles Chargers (who might also compete for top seed but encounter the same problem) and additionally the Packers on the schedule
The Indianapolis also play the Kansas City, and have the Seattle, San Francisco and two games with the five and four Jaguars to face. There is a considerable distance to travel but the opportunity is open for a shock top seed in the American Football Conference
Coming Up - Rams & Seahawks Set for Next Week Clash
Both squads with strong arguments to be superior to all of the three different 8-2 sides are National Football Conference West opponents the Seattle and Los Angeles, who both scored 40 burgers to go to 7-2 before the upcoming major game between the pair in Los Angeles
Both have won four in a consecutive games, have signal callers in Stafford and Sam Darnold playing at an high standard (although Darnold had ball security problems on Sunday) with top receivers, and defenses allowing fewer than twenty points a game
Both could easily be without a loss as well - especially the Los Angeles as their pair of losses came in extra time against the 49ers and then that painful defeat in Philly when they had a game-winning kick with the last kick deflected and run back by the Philadelphia for a score
Seattle were also defeated to San Francisco, with a last-minute score in week one, before losing to the last kick of the contest against the Buccaneers - so they're truly among the best sides in the league
The upcoming game on Sunday could be the best of the year to date
